Change the numbers by highlighting them and using the Up and
Down arrow buttons to increase or decrease the number. The
factory default Port settings are:
Remote
Admin: 8200
Remote
Callback:
8201
Remote
Watch: 8016
Remote
Search: 10019
Remote Audio: 8116
